Definitions

  • n. (pejorative connotation) A singer, entertainer; a low-class person with no ambition.

Example Sentences

  • "Though he obtained a high level of musicianship, people still identified him as a motreb."

  • "As Younes Dardashti was becoming one of the most famous singers in the country's history, Iran's Jewish community still saw him as a motreb – a derogatory word for an entertainer – a class on par with prostitution, due to the role that Jewish performers-for-hire once played in society." Languages of Origin

  • Arabic / Judeo-Arabic
  • Persian

Etymology

  • A > P مطرب motreb

    • Who Uses This

      • Persian: Jews with recent ancestry in Iran

      Regions

      • North America

      Dictionaries

      • None
